Transaction 73b77ecaefc048eedb44a56f3050560c1e7f426c1e2fbec442c3fd6586bec213
1 Input
1 Output
-
73b77ecaefc048eedb44a56f3050560c1e7f426c1e2fbec442c3fd6586bec213:0
- value
- 1403354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9422d59190b1ca9caab4a7e7bd152e836d9faadd OP_EQUAL
- address
- 3FCHfG64v76Y4M1YJXHcEkL3hhctesYSEj